"[Being vegan] improved my performance off and on the field. Plant-based foods have no cholesterol, so I don’t have a cholesterol issue. My blood pressure is good, and the toxicity level in my body is good. You’re able to take more energy from plant-based sources than animal-based sources. The list goes on, and it translates to the field and how I recover."
